Early Steps and Stardom

Danica's acting journey began when she was quite young, working alongside her younger sister, Crystal McKellar, in their mother's dance studio. This early exposure to performance, you know, set the stage for what was to come. It was a place where they could both explore their creative sides and get comfortable with being in front of people.

In 1982, her family made a big change, moving to Los Angeles. This move, naturally, opened up more doors for her in the entertainment field. Just a few years later, she got her first appearance in a commercial, which is often a starting point for many young performers. This was, basically, her first step into the wider world of acting.

Following that, she had a few guest spots on "The Twilight Zone" in 1985. These smaller roles, you know, helped her gain experience and visibility. Then came her big moment, a breakthrough role in "The Wonder Years" in 1988, which really made her a household name. She also, apparently, managed to keep up with her studies, getting good grades during this busy time.

From Child Star to Math Champion

After her time as a child star, Danica McKellar pursued a different kind of challenge. She graduated from UCLA in 1998 with a bachelor's degree in mathematics, achieving a very high academic honor. This accomplishment, in a way, showed her dedication to learning beyond the acting world.

Since earning her degree, she has written 11 books for children on the subject of mathematics. These books, like "Goodnight, Numbers," "Ten Magic Butterflies," and the widely known "Math Doesn't Suck" and "Kiss My Math," are designed to make math approachable for middle school and high school students. She has, you know, become a strong voice for encouraging women to pursue careers in science, technology, engineering, and math, often called STEM fields.

Her work in demystifying math education has, honestly, earned her wide recognition. She's not just an actress; she's also a New York Times bestselling author of math books for young people, with sales exceeding a million copies since 2007. This effort, in fact, shows her passion for making complex subjects easier to understand for a younger audience.

The Arrival of Danica McKellar's Son

Danica McKellar welcomed her son, Draco, into the world in 2010. The journey to his arrival was, apparently, quite a significant one for her. She experienced a day and a half of natural labor to bring him into her life.

Despite the length of the labor, she has mentioned that she barely remembers a moment of it. This can be, you know, a common experience for new mothers, where the intensity of the event fades into a blur of joy and new beginnings. It highlights the profound nature of becoming a parent.

Helping Children in Need

One of the organizations Danica feels deeply connected to is the My Stuff Bags Foundation. This foundation provides, in fact, strong support for children across the United States and Canada who have been abused, abandoned, or neglected. Her involvement with such a cause speaks volumes about her character.

The My Stuff program, which the foundation runs, was created to offer comfort to children during times of crisis. It aims to make their welcome in a safe, but perhaps unfamiliar, place a little warmer. This initiative, you know, helps these young ones feel a sense of security when they need it most.
